From: Stochastic synchronization of neuronal populations with intrinsic and extrinsic noise

Fig. 6

Probability distribution of the phase difference between a pair of E-I oscillators as a function of extrinsic noise strength σ with g, h given by Figure 4. Solid curves are based on analytical calculations, whereas black (gray) filled circles correspond to stochastic simulations of the phase-reduced (planar) Langevin equations. (a)N= 10 5 , σ=0.01. The curve is very flat, showing little synchronization. (b)N= 10 5 , σ=0.08. Increasing σ causes the curve to have a much sharper peak and much more synchronization.
